Cardiff IAP Runway in use 30
Visitors
Parked on stand 6 is Air Charter Express DC-8-63AF 9G-AXA ..departed 10:14 to Lyneham as "ACE121"
Due in from Baltimore-Washington at 08:31 is Challenger 604 N459CS c/n 5546 ..landed 09:02 parking echo
Landing at 09:58 is regular weekender Cessna 206 EI-SPB parking echo
Due in from Luton at 10:05 is "NJE3FZ" Citation 560XL CS-DXE c/n 560-5578, due out to Newquay at 11:40 ..landed 09:56 parking echo ..departed 11:29
Inbound 10:40 is Cessna F.182Q N182GC ..landed 10:56 and parking on echo
Inbound 10:55 is "CWL 91" a 55[R]Sqdn Dominie XS709/M ..landed 11:00 parking on stand 16 ..departed 12:49
Landing 11:35 is "CWL 92" a Dominie XS713/C of 55[R]Sqdn ..parking on stand 15 ..departed 13:18
Inbound 12:20 from the East via the Cardiff docks VRP is Halfpenny Green based "diesel powered" PA-28 Warrior II G-CEGS ..landed 12:32 and parking Southside ..departed 13:49
Landing at 13:30 is "Grossmann 101" Dornier 328Jet OE-HTG parking echo
Due in at 16:30 from Lydd is PA-46 N930Z ..landed 17:09 parking southside, departs early AM Sunday
Due in from Palma Mallorca at 17:01 is "AVB871" Citation 560XL G-XBEL c/n 560-5698 ..departs 17:55 to Jersey as "AVB872" ..landed 18:06 parking stand 15 ..departed 18:23
